Layout

Checkpoint is a medium size bunker style map, the map has custom spawns made in place with human spawn outside in front of the bunker entrance, and zombie spawn starting behind the collapsed tunnel entrance (While zombie spawn expands outward closer to the bunker on wave 3 and 6).


The map has 3 unique prop entities called Power Cores, these cores are vital for survival as they're needed to unlock the bases' main functionalities; opening the bunker entrance, unlocking the medical bay and armory, and powering up the Takara Holy Laser Cannon IV (Note: laser cannon no longer works with current map version.)


Power Cores can only be collected once the charges break the cavein. Once round starts the cores will be in 3 separate locations; one is located in the supply truck right behind the cavein rocks, the second located in the oil derrick room to the right next to the dead base commander, and the last core is located in the very bottom of the water purification room to the left underneath smaller water pipes.


Once using one of the cores to open the bunker entrance, the bunker splits into the first 3 passage ways humans can travel to, heading left or right will lead humans to one of the side entrances of the bunker with red and green buttons that controls the lock/unlock functions to them (green being unlock and red locked).


On second 3 passage way further down the middle, heading left will lead humans to the armory and the power room, heading right will lead to the medical bay and pipe room, continuing through the middle will lead humans to their final destination, the control room.
